Understanding ERP Systems
ERP systems are integrated software solutions designed to manage and automate various business processes within an organization. These systems help companies improve operational efficiency by providing real-time visibility into critical functions such as inventory management, production planning, order processing, and financial management. For manufacturing companies, a robust ERP system can be a game-changer, facilitating better decision-making and resource allocation.
The Need for Custom ERP Solutions
While off-the-shelf ERP solutions offer a range of functionalities, they may not always meet the unique needs of manufacturing companies in Belgium. Custom ERP development allows businesses to create tailored solutions that align with their specific requirements, workflows, and industry standards. Here are some compelling reasons why manufacturing companies should consider investing in custom ERP solutions:
1. Tailored Features and Functionality
Every manufacturing company has its own set of processes and challenges. Custom ERP solutions can be designed with features that cater specifically to the needs of the business, such as advanced production scheduling, quality control management, and compliance tracking. This tailored approach ensures that the ERP system enhances productivity and addresses the unique pain points of the organization.
2. Seamless Integration with Existing Systems
Manufacturing companies often use various software systems for accounting, inventory management, and customer relationship management (CRM). A custom ERP solution can be built with an API-based architecture, enabling seamless integration with existing ERP, CRM, and accounting systems. This ensures that data flows smoothly across platforms, reducing the chances of errors and improving overall efficiency.
3. Scalability
As manufacturing companies grow, so do their operational needs. Custom ERP solutions can be designed with scalability in mind, allowing organizations to easily adapt to increased production demands or changes in the market. Whether it's adding new functionalities, accommodating more users, or integrating with additional systems, a custom ERP solution can evolve alongside the business.
4. Enhanced Data Security
Data security is a top priority for manufacturing companies, especially those operating in highly regulated industries. Custom ERP development allows for the implementation of security measures that comply with industry standards, such as ISO 27001 and GDPR. By adopting a Security by Design approach, businesses can ensure that sensitive data is protected from unauthorized access and breaches.
5. Improved User Experience
Custom ERP solutions can be designed with user experience in mind, featuring intuitive interfaces and workflows that align with how employees work. A user-friendly system reduces training time and increases adoption rates, leading to a smoother transition and better overall performance.
Key Features of Custom ERP Solutions for Manufacturing
When developing a custom ERP solution for manufacturing companies in Belgium, certain key features should be prioritized to maximize effectiveness:
1. Production Management
A robust production management module allows manufacturers to plan, schedule, and monitor production processes efficiently. Features such as real-time tracking, resource allocation, and capacity planning help optimize production workflows.
2. Inventory Management
Effective inventory management is crucial for manufacturing companies to minimize costs and avoid stockouts. Custom ERP solutions should include tools for tracking inventory levels, managing supplier relationships, and automating reorder processes.
3. Quality Control
Maintaining high quality standards is essential for manufacturing success. A custom ERP system can incorporate quality control features that monitor production quality, track defects, and manage compliance with industry regulations.
4. Financial Management
Comprehensive financial management capabilities, including budgeting, forecasting, and reporting, are vital for manufacturing companies. Custom ERP solutions can provide insights into financial performance, enabling better resource allocation and strategic decision-making.
5. Reporting and Analytics
Data-driven decision-making is key to staying competitive in the manufacturing sector. Custom ERP solutions can offer advanced reporting and analytics tools that provide insights into operational performance, helping companies identify trends and areas for improvement.
Implementation of Custom ERP Solutions
The implementation of a custom ERP solution requires careful planning and execution. Here are the key steps involved in the process:
1. Needs Assessment
The first step is to conduct a thorough needs assessment to identify the specific requirements of the manufacturing company. This involves gathering input from stakeholders across various departments to ensure that the custom ERP solution addresses all critical areas.
2. Solution Design
Once the requirements are clear, the next step is to design the custom ERP solution. This includes defining the architecture, user interface, and key features that will be implemented.
3. Development
The development phase involves coding the custom ERP solution, ensuring that it adheres to clean code principles such as SOLID and DRY. This ensures that the codebase is maintainable and scalable.
4. Testing
Thorough testing is crucial before deployment. This includes functional testing, performance testing, and security testing aligned with OWASP standards. Regular penetration testing should also be conducted to identify potential vulnerabilities.
5. Deployment and Training
After successful testing, the custom ERP solution can be deployed. It's essential to provide training for employees to ensure they are comfortable using the new system.
6. Ongoing Support and Maintenance
Post-launch support is vital to address any issues that may arise and to implement necessary updates and improvements. Regular performance monitoring ensures that the ERP system continues to meet the evolving needs of the manufacturing company.
Challenges in Custom ERP Development
While custom ERP development offers numerous advantages, there are also challenges to consider:
1. Resource Intensive
Custom ERP development can be resource-intensive, requiring significant time and investment. Companies must allocate adequate resources for planning, development, and implementation.
2. Change Management
Transitioning to a custom ERP solution may face resistance from employees accustomed to existing workflows. Effective change management strategies are essential for ensuring a smooth transition.
3. Ongoing Maintenance
Custom ERP solutions require ongoing maintenance and updates to remain relevant and secure. Companies must allocate resources for long-term support.
